Business Context and Reporting Period
This Form 8-K reports the results of the Annual Meeting of Stockholders held by Bio-Rad Laboratories, Inc. on April 25, 2017. The filing details the outcomes of six specific proposals submitted to security holders for a vote.

Material Changes and Voting Results
The following matters were voted upon and approved by stockholders:
- Election of Directors: All nominated directors were elected. Class A directors (Melinda Litherland, Arnold A. Pinkston) received over 19.9 million votes each. Class B directors (Jeffrey L. Edwards, Gregory K. Hinckley, Alice N. Schwartz, Norman Schwartz) received between 4.92 million and 4.93 million votes each.
- Auditor Ratification: The selection of KPMG LLP as independent auditors for the fiscal year ending December 31, 2017, was ratified with 7,279,650 votes in favor.
- 2017 Incentive Award Plan: Approved with 6,030,772 votes in favor and 927,471 votes against.
- Employee Stock Purchase Plan Amendment: An amendment to increase authorized shares by 700,000 was approved with 6,958,695 votes in favor.
- Executive Compensation (Say-on-Pay): The non-binding advisory vote was approved with 6,894,740 votes in favor.
- Frequency of Say-on-Pay Votes: Stockholders voted to hold future advisory votes on executive compensation every three years (5,806,177 votes for 3 years).
